Sijo01: Am sharing this personal experience on how money mysteriously disappeared from my pocket for all who cares to read to be fully guarded and watchful this season and beyond.
Am still confused, in shock and still can’t put one or two together on how this happened.
I left home for the salon around 3:30 pm yesterday (29/11/2015) after empting my wallet and clearing all cash in sight with the aim of buying drugs for my toothache and doing light shopping on my way back home. The cash was neatly kept in my jeans pocket with exception to N100 which will take me to my destination. I held the N100 with my phones and keys in my hand; boarded a bus to New Benin; paying no attention to other passengers. I was glued to my phone (Nairalanding). On getting to New Benin, I gave the Driver N100 and he gave me a change of N50. Still held the N50 in my hand and boarded another Bus going to 3rd junction. As usual, I was still glued to my phone. I gave the conductor the N50 and collected my N10 change. On getting to 3rd Junction after alighting from the bus, I decided to keep the N10 with the other cash in my pocket. Bingo! My pocket was EMPTY. I went back to the bus searched the floor , my money was not in sight. I was confused and my throat suddenly went dry. I looked around and saw a girl selling sachet water. I flagged her down, bought one with my last N10 and re-energized myself with the water.
I was still in that state of confusion not knowing what to do and how to get back home when I saw a colleague. After exchanging pleasantries, I told her my predicament. To God be the glory, she had enough money on her and she bailed me out.
